  11. James Taylor and His Band of Legends I saw him Wednesday night in Raleigh; the third show on this tour. He and this hand-picked band recorded a live CD of cover tunes back in January which is due out later in the year. This is very different for him - not playing covers, but having an album full of them. The band is huge - 12 players including JT. Among them are drummer Steve Gadd, a VERY well known and versatile session drummer that I remember from his brilliant performance on Steely Dan's "Aja;" and "Blue Lou" Marini of Blues Brothers fame (who now looks like Albert Einstein). They played a lot of the covers - probably 8-10 tunes. The best of them was "Wichita Lineman," and old Glenn Campbell tune. There were a couple of really sleepy ones I could have done without, including "On Broadway" by the Drifters, which NOBODY does better than George Benson (nobody). There was a good mix of his old favorites and some of his recent stuff, but some tunes were noticeably absent, like "Fire and Rain." Lots of interaction with the audience (which he has always done - such a goof). He even added a song to his set list by request of a lady in the front ("Mighty Storm"). Three encore reappearances, the first of which he spent time on his knees at the edge of the stage signing autographs. He is a class act. Honestly, I enjoyed him better when I saw him in 1990 in Vermont. There was more of his own stuff, the venue was tiny, and he played for us in the steady light rain. The arrangements with the big band are cool though, and Steve Gadd just plain kicks ass. Arrive Safely John
  12. First, a rule of thumb for everyone: always reply directly to the post you are referring to (directly to the person you are talking to) in a post, not just the last reply in a string. Most of the valuable content that gets culled from a thread because a post above it was removed by a Moderator happens because of this. The good post falls in the string below the bad one: ORIGINAL GOOD GOOD GOOD GOOD GOOD BAD GOOD (will go out with the trash) GOOD (will go out with the trash) If the Moderator catches the garbage post early enough, editing is an option. If the garbage has turned into multiple replies, it's just too much work. If it's only one or two good posts that got removed, I will copy and paste each post into a PM to the original poster so he can put it back again. If there are too many of those, again it's just too much work. Arrive Safely John
